Frequently Asked Questions about Boca Raton
How much are Studio apartments in Boca Raton?
There are currently 175 Studio Apartments in Boca Raton with rent ranges from $950 to $4,097 with an average price of $1,978.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Boca Raton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Boca Raton ranges from $1,150 to $4,387 with an average monthly rent of $2,285.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Boca Raton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Boca Raton range from $1,200 to $6,938.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,976.
How expensive are Boca Raton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 156 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Boca Raton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,559 to $8,928 - averaging $3,507 for the location.
